Understanding Football Betting Basics
Football betting can be tricky for beginners. But knowing the basics helps you make smart choices. Betting odds show how much you could win. Bookmakers use two main types: fractional and decimal odds.
Fractional odds show winnings over stake. For example, 50/1 means you win £50 for every £1 bet. Decimal odds show total returns on a £1 bet. For instance, 51.00 means you get £51 back total.
Common Betting Terms for Beginners
Learning common betting terms is crucial. Here are some important ones:
- Moneyline: Betting on the outright winner of a match, regardless of the margin of victory.
- Point Spreads: Betting on the margin of victory, with one team giving a handicap to the other.
- Totals (Over/Under): Betting on the total number of goals scored in a match, with the option to bet over or under a specified number.
- Parlays: Combining multiple bets into a single wager, with the potential for higher payouts but increased risk.
- Proposition Bets: Betting on individual player or team-based outcomes within a match, such as the first goalscorer.
- Round Robins: A series of parlay bets placed on multiple outcomes, with the ability to win even if not all selections are successful.
- Futures: Betting on long-term outcomes, such as the winner of a league or tournament.
The Role of Implied Probability
Implied probability turns odds into a percentage. It shows how likely an outcome is, according to the bookmaker. This includes the bookmaker’s margin, their built-in profit.
Understanding implied probability helps find value bets. It lets you make smarter choices when betting on football.

Essential Football Betting Markets and Types
Football betting offers many markets and bet types. From 1X2 betting to Asian handicap, options abound for smart punters. Let’s explore key football betting markets and their role in betting strategies.
1X2 Betting: This simple market lets you bet on the match result. You can choose home win (1), draw (X), or away win (2). Odds show the likely outcome, making it easy for beginners.
Asian Handicap: This market evens the odds by giving a handicap. It often favors the weaker team, offering better value. Asian handicap bets range from -2.5 to +2.5.
Over/Under Markets: These bets focus on total goals scored. You can wager if the final score will be over or under a set number. This adds excitement to the game.
Other markets include Double Chance, Draw No Bet, and Correct Score. Each offers unique challenges and chances for smart football bettors.

Developing a Bankroll Management Plan
Effective bankroll management is key to betting success. The Kelly Criterion helps determine optimal bet sizes. It’s based on your perceived probability and the bookmaker’s odds.
This formula prevents risking too much or too little. It allows for steady bankroll growth over time.
